The Science Behind First Day of Winter

Seasons are driven by the tilt of Earth's axis — roughly 23.5 degrees — not by how close the planet is to the Sun. As Earth orbits, each hemisphere leans toward or away from the Sun, changing the angle of sunlight and the length of the day. The astronomical start of a season is pinned to a solstice or an equinox, the precise moment that geometry reaches a turning point.

That is why the start of First Day of Winter 2027 lands on a specific date and even a specific time, rather than the first of a month. Equinoxes bring near-equal day and night worldwide; solstices mark the longest or shortest day of the year. Knowing the exact changeover is useful for gardeners, photographers, and anyone tracking daylight hours.

What causes First Day of Winter to begin?

First Day of Winter begins because of the 23.5-degree tilt of Earth's axis. As the planet orbits the Sun, each hemisphere leans toward or away from it, changing sunlight and day length. The season's astronomical start is pinned to a solstice or equinox.

Is the start of First Day of Winter the same date every year?

Not exactly. Because the solstice and equinox follow Earth's orbit rather than the calendar, the start of First Day of Winter can shift by a day or two from year to year. 2027 has its own precise changeover date and time.

What is the difference between meteorological and astronomical First Day of Winter?

Meteorological seasons are fixed three-month blocks used by forecasters, while astronomical seasons are defined by solstices and equinoxes. The date counted here is the astronomical start of First Day of Winter 2027.
